Summary:

Zip code 29605 is home to exactly one middle school, Hughes Academy of Science and Technology, a grades 6-8 school in Greenville, SC, serving 999 students within the Greenville 01 district.

For parents considering this area, Hughes Academy is a consistently strong performer, ranking in the top quarter of South Carolina middle schools for three straight years. Its standout achievement is an extraordinary 98.37% pass rate on the Algebra 1 EOCEP exam, far exceeding district (85.64%) and state (73.95%) averages—though this likely reflects selective placement of high-achieving 8th graders into the course. The school also shows clear momentum in mathematics: 8th grade math proficiency jumped 12.5 points year-over-year (from 35.1% to 47.6%), with 7th grade math improving 8 points. Across all grades, math and ELA scores generally beat state averages, with 6th grade math (51.5%) and 6th grade science (60.0%) leading the way. However, math proficiency declines as grade level rises (51.5% in 6th, 49.6% in 7th, 47.6% in 8th), suggesting stronger foundational instruction than advanced coursework.

Operationally, the school spends $11,720 per student with a 16.6:1 student-teacher ratio, which appears efficient given its above-average results. The main concern is chronic absenteeism at 23.3%, slightly above district (22.5%) and state (22.3%) levels—meaning nearly one in four students misses significant school time, a potential risk to future performance. Overall, Hughes Academy offers a solid, above-average education with particular strengths in early-grade math, ELA, and advanced Algebra placement, making it a reliable choice for families in the 29605 area.
